Abstract

A result of the search for the top quark in e+e- annihilation into hadrons at =50GeV is presented. The experiment has been performed using the VENUS detector at TRISTAN. No evidence has been found for the production of the top quark. From the study using the event shape of the multihadron events, the upper limit of the production cross section is found to be 16 pb at the 95% confidence level.
